I read this in one day whilst travelling to and from Sheffield. It tells the story of the early years of Novalis and his search for some sort of meaning in life. He meets and falls in love with Sophie, a 12-year-old girl who seemingly loves him back and they agree to marry, much to the amusement of his friends and the consternation of his family. The story is, I think, more Sophie's than Fritz's but it is a moving story nonetheless.
